Founded in 1967, our client is a specialist in the manufacture, repair, and maintenance of all types of shutters, industrial and commercial doors, gates, and barriers. Operating 24/7, 365 days a year, they are committed to delivering exceptional service, focusing on quality and customer satisfaction.

How to prepare for a job interview at Talent Finder
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of roller shutters and industrial doors. Familiarise yourself with the different types, their mechanisms, and common issues. This will show your potential employer that you're not just interested in the job, but that you genuinely understand the industry.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are to discuss your previous work experience in detail. Think about specific projects you've worked on, challenges you've faced, and how you overcame them. This is your chance to demonstrate your problem-solving skills and technical expertise, which are crucial for this role.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Come prepared with questions that show your interest in the company and the role. Ask about their approach to safety, the types of projects they handle, or how they support their engineers' professional development.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
✨Be Ready for Practical Tests
Since this role involves hands-on work, be prepared for practical assessments during the interview. Brush up on your technical skills and be ready to demonstrate your ability to troubleshoot or repair a door mechanism. This will give you an edge and prove that you can deliver in real-world scenarios.
